THUNDER BAY -- A former two-time federal NDP candidate has filed to run in Neebing Ward.
Yuk-Sem Won, who finished third in Thunder Bay-Rainy River in both the 2019 and 2021 elections, on Thursday announced she would seek a seat on Thunder Bay city council in the Oct. 24 municipal election.
"I believe in advocacy, professionalism, respect and my community. I want to bring my experience, skills and voice to the Leadership of our City With integrity and passion. Thank you to my family and supporters who believe I can be part of the positive change we all strive to see in the coming years," Won said in a release.
The seat is up for grabs, with incumbent Cody Fraser announcing he won't seek re-election.
Won joins Shaun Kennedy, Debra Halvorsen and Greg Johnsen on the ballot in Neebing.
The deadline to file is Friday at 2 p.m.
